What is reachable on Patreon without signing in

Patreon links arrive in two shapes and we route them differently. A post or album URL goes to the gallery extractor, which walks the attached files; a stream URL goes to the media extractor, which negotiates renditions. Paste either and the right one picks it up. The extractor covers 5 separate Patreon URL shapes, so a link copied from anywhere on the site usually resolves as-is. Patreon supports signed-in sessions upstream, which is precisely how it hides private material; we browse anonymously, so that material stays hidden. The renditions we see from Patreon arrive as MP4.

Patreon is wired into both extractors. A post or album URL goes to the gallery route and returns the files attached to it; a stream URL goes to the media route and returns one negotiated rendition. Same box, different machinery, decided by the shape of the link.

No, and that is deliberate. Patreon gates private material behind a signed-in session; we fetch as an anonymous browser and hold no credentials, so we see exactly what a logged-out visitor sees. If a post needs a follow request to view, it needs one to download.

Among others: campaign, creator, post, user. Those are separate URL shapes with separate handling behind them, which is why a link that looks nothing like the last one you pasted still works.

MP4 — whatever Patreon itself serves. The container is passed straight through rather than rebuilt, so there is no second round of compression between the platform's copy and yours.

No. 5 different Patreon URL shapes are recognised, which covers the ordinary address-bar URL, the share variant and most of the odd ones in between. Paste whatever you copied; if it is the Patreon address it will almost certainly resolve.

Seconds, normally. Items on Patreon are typically short, so the file is small and the transfer is over almost as soon as it starts. If it stalls, that is a connection problem rather than a queue — there is no queue.

You get the best progressive rendition Patreon publishes for that item, chosen automatically. There is no upscaling on offer, because inventing pixels that Patreon never encoded would make the file bigger and not better.

Not by us. There is no re-encode step in the path, so the file you get is bit-for-bit what Patreon served. Whatever compression Patreon applied when it accepted the upload is already baked in and cannot be undone by anyone.
